ELKHARTLAKE - Bonnie was born on November 18, 1940 in Aurora, Illinois and December 31, 2018 began a new life under the heavenly care and love of God. She grew up, was educated and worked in the Racine, Wisconsin area. On April 22, 1972 she was united in marriage to John F. Stoelting and they enjoyed life together for 46 years.

Bonnie was exceptional in all of her endeavors as a mother, a sports mom, a Sunday school teacher, a bowler, a Supervisor and Clerk-Treasurer for the Town of Rhine, an entrepreneur in her business, Midwest Monograms, as a cook, a knitter and as a best friend and wife.

She is succeeded in life by Jason Stoelting (!Brianna Parke) of Seattle, Washington; Adam, Shannon, Jane and Benjamin Stoelting of Chicago, Illinois; her sister Barbara (Les) Clugg of Union Grove, Wisconsin; her brother Rick Meyer of Puyallup, Washington and her husband John of Elkhart Lake, Wisconsin. She was preceded in death by her mother Kelly Meyer of Racine, WI, her father, Lee Winterhalter of Firth, Nebraska and her sister, Arlene Lungdstrom of Freeport, Ill.

Funeral services for

Bonnie and the immediate family were officiated by Michael Mathes of St. Peters United Church of Christ at the Kiel Cemetery on January 5, 2019.

Memorials have been established at Bonnie’s request for St. Jude Children’s Research Hospital and St. Peters Un! ited Church of Christ in Kiel, Wisconsin.
